The Androscoggin Community Health Stakeholder Coalition invite members and Lewiston/Auburn invitees to attend this program.
The Impact of Experience: How Adverse Childhood Experiences and Positive Childhood Experiences Impact Healthy Child Development
Join this virtual training to gain a comprehensive understanding of how both adverse and positive childhood experiences sculpt the foundation of individual development and uncover the transformative potential of PCEs in nurturing the children you work with.
